Thanks everyone. I think that was the most nerve wracking part of the evening. And I couldn't tell if it was working, as I was working!! We were able to get Joss, Jessica and b!X interviewed after Serenity started, and that footage will be added to the video and available soon.

Insider scoop: I watched Jessica give her intro talk, then Joss wanted to see the crowd's reaction to the DVD, so we all (Joss and his wife Kai, Amanda, Michael, Felicia, Nathan, Jane, Tim) and some of my team, walked around to the theater door and crept in. The audience was totally attentive, and when Joss came on the screen, well you heard what happened!! I know there were more than a few moist eyes after that. We all then had to rush back so that Jessica could introduce Joss. After that, it was a bit of a blur for me, but we pretty much kept to the timeline I had made, and we even managed to get everyone out of the theater a few minutes before our cut off time!!! I had the time of my life, and knowing that so many people were watching and hearing about Equality Now's work, and seeing Joss, and being able to participate in the Q&A via Twitter, WOW!! It will be hard to duplicate this next year, but I am going to give it my best shot!!
